China-Europe Railway Express southern route from Chengdu launches regular mixed-load freight service

(ECNS) -- Mixed-load public-block trains on the southern route of the China-Europe Railway Express (Chengdu) are now operating regularly, with three to four departures per month, according to Chengdu International Railway Port on Monday. 

Leaving China via Khorgos Port in Xinjiang Uygur Autonomous Region, the train travels across Kazakhstan and the Caspian Sea before reaching Poti and Tbilisi in Georgia.

The service also connects with several other Eurasian cities, including Baku in Azerbaijan and Izmir in Türkiye.

Chengdu International Railway Port has developed a logistics network combining trans-Caspian and trans-Black Sea rail-sea intermodal transport with all-rail services.

In April this year, the port launched a return service from Izmir, Türkiye, establishing two-way freight connectivity along the route.
